  16. This makes me think of long time Baltimore Orioles coach, Earl Weaver. Earl didn't play small ball and wasn't considered a "Genius". But the Orioles won, and they did it by scoring a lot of runs and having the pitching. In 1971, the Orioles became the first team since the 1920 White Sox to have 4 20 game winners, Jim Palmer, Dave McNally, Mike Cuellar and Pat Dobson.
